9.3.1. Check Point (Handset)
Please follow the items below when BBIC or EEPROM is replaced.
Note:
After the measuring, suck up the solder of TP.
*: PC Setting (P.59) is required beforehand.
The connections of simulator equipments are as shown in Adjustment Standard (Handset) (P.61).
Items Check
Point
Procedure Check or
Replace Parts
(A)* 1.8V Supply Adjustment VDD1 1. Confirm that the voltage between test point VDD1 and GND is 1.8V ± 0.02V.
2. Execute the command “bandgap”, then check the current Value.
3. Adjust the 1.8V voltage of VDD1 executing command “bandgap XX” (XX is the
value).
IC1, Q2, C10
(B) DC/DC Supply Confir-
mation
VDD3 1. Confirm that the voltage between test point VDD3 and GND is 3.6V ± 0.3V
(Backlight is OFF)/4.2V ± 0.3V (Backlight is ON).
IC1, F1, C1,
C2, C3, R1,
Q1, D1, L1, D2
(C) 2.5V Supply Confirma-
tion
VDD2 1. Confirm that the voltage between test point VDD2 and GND is 2.5V ± 0.1V. IC1, Q3, C4,
C5
(D)* BBIC Confirmation - 1. BBIC Confirmation (Execute the command “getchk”).
2. Confirm the returned checksum value.
